The Japanese Friendship Garden (JFG) and Buddhist Temple of San Diego (BTSD) host the annual Bon Odori Festival! They are proud to continue the tradition of celebrating the circle of life together?as has been done each summer in Japan for generations?and to welcome everyone to join the celebration!

For two days you can shop from a variety of merchants, engage in family-friendly activities, and treat yourselves to Japanese festival foods, a beer garden, and a tea and dessert garden. Experience cultural performances throughout each day, which will also be highlighted with traditional Bon Odori practices.

On August 3, you'll be able to make your own toro nagashi, either to take home or set afloat at JFG. Lanterns will be sold for $10 at the Inamori Pavilion on a first come, first served basis. Lantern making kits will be available only until 5:00 PM. Lantern floating is scheduled to begin at 7:00 PM at the lower garden.

On August 4, the festival will extend out to the Organ Pavilion at 4:00 PM where everyone will be invited to participate in the Bon Odori dance. The Organ Pavilion will be decorated with paper lanterns, Japanese folk tunes, and while taiko fills the air, dance leaders in traditional kimono will guide participants into a large dance circle!
